This is an easy-going 7.5 mile route on the Spen Valley Greenway going from Cleckheaton towards Low Moor, Bradford. This greenway boasts great views and trailside sculptures in a traffic-free environment, starting out at Princess Mary Stadium car park on Bradford Road in Liversedge. The greenway follows the path of the former Lancashire and Yorkshire Railway – keen-eyed individuals can spot the LYR boundary stones and other artefacts from this line. It has recently been converted into a dedicated cycle track, part of Sustrans’ National Cycle Network Route 66, from Dewsbury to Low Moor.

It is all traffic free and suitable for all bikes.
